Mercer University's Department of Behavioral Health and Developmental Disabilities is searching for a Patient Experience Coordinator.


 

Responsibilities:

Working under the supervision of the Center for IDD Care Nurse Manager, the Patient Experience Coordinator serves as a vital support to patients and their families as they navigate the complexities of illness, injury, disability, trauma, or hospitalization. This position is focused on addressing the psychosocial needs of patients, including mental, emotional, and social aspects, to ensure a compassionate and supportive care environment. The Patient Experience Coordinator functions as a bridge between patients, families, and the interdisciplinary healthcare team, with a special focus on patients with intellectual and developmental disabilities (IDD).

Qualifications:

A Registered Behavior Technician (RBT) certification or an associate's or bachelor's degree in behavioral health, psychology, social work, or a related field and six months of experience in a clinical setting are required. Candidates must have experience with EMR, Microsoft Products, and be CPR certified.

Founded in 1833, Mercer University is a distinguished private institution recognized for its commitment to academic excellence, leadership development, and community engagement. With campuses across Georgia, Mercer’s twelve schools and colleges offer a wide range of undergraduate, graduate, and professional programs. The university cultivates a close-knit, student-centered environment where innovation, service, and personal growth are deeply valued.
